24-26 May 2009, John Van Berlo
Location: Mitta Mitta River Time: 6.30am-5.30pm
Type of Water: River Type of Fishing: Shore
Target Fish: Trout
Bait\Lure\Fly: Worms
Fish Caught: 50+ x trout @ 1lb-5lb
Comments: Three of us returned for my annual trip to the Mitta. Water was low and very clear. Fished near Anglers Rest and the Bundarra junction, also the Hinnomunjie area.  Great to see the area has returned to its majestic splendour after fires a few years back.  Weather was fantastic with little or no rain and no wind, although it was cold.  Caught no female fish, which was unusual. Kept our possession limit, and the rest were returned unharmed.  Will see if we can make this a twice yearly event.

25-27 April 2008, John
Location: Mitta Mitta River Time: All day
Type of Water: River Type of Fishing: Shore
Target Fish: Trout
Bait\Lure\Fly: Worms
Fish Caught: 8 x brown trout @ 2lb-3lb
2 x brown trout @ 1lb
Lots x brown trout @ less than 1lb
Comments: Fished various locations around the Anglers Rest area near and upstream of the Bundarra Junction. River low and very clear. Fish were easily spooked but were there if you were careful and patient. Casting behind rocks and logs proved to be the key. Took our bag and released the rest. One of the best weekends I've had in years.
